Zohaib Maladwala combines a strong work ethic, strategic thinking, and practical judgment to secure optimal outcomes for his clients. With significant experience in class action defence, product liability and complex commercial litigation, Zohaib works closely with clients across a range of industries including life sciences/pharmaceuticals, automotive, mining, technology, industrial and consumer products, and professional/financial services. He is Vice-Chair of Fasken’s Ontario Litigation and Dispute Resolution Practice Group.
Zohaib has played an instrumental role in the successful defence of multiple precedent-setting class actions across Canada. This includes the successful dismissal at certification of proposed class actions against Fiat Chrysler Automobiles in Ontario and Saskatchewan alleging the use of defeat devices; the successful dismissal at certification of proposed class actions in Ontario and British Columbia against a global pharmaceutical company alleging negligent design, manufacture, and failure to warn in connection with the Valsartan and Ranitidine (Zantac) drugs; and successfully staying a franchise class action in Ontario pre-certification.
Zohaib’s product liability acumen extends to providing advice to clients on matters relating to product recalls, regulatory requirements, and consumer protection. Zohaib also frequently represents clients in complex commercial disputes including breach of contract cases, shareholder disputes and contentious estate matters, where he has represented both trustees and beneficiaries.
